Strategy Pros Cons
Martingale System
  • Simple and easy to follow
  • Potential for quick recovery of losses
  • Requires a substantial bankroll
  • Can hit table limits quickly
Fibonacci Strategy
  • Less aggressive than Martingale
  • Encourages disciplined betting
  • Slow recovery of losses
  • May lead to prolonged losing streaks
D’Alembert Strategy
  • Moderate betting increases
  • Balances risk and reward
  • Can be slow to yield profits
  • Less effective in volatile conditions

The Bad

Despite the enticing prospects, there are inherent drawbacks to consider. The following factors can detract from the overall experience:

  • House Edge: Regardless of the strategy employed, the house maintains an advantage, making it statistically challenging to beat the odds consistently.
  • Risk of Bankroll Depletion: High-stakes players may succumb to the temptation of chasing losses, leading to significant financial downturns.
  • Complexity of Strategies: Many strategies require a deep understanding of betting patterns, which may overwhelm less experienced players.

The Ugly

In the pursuit of success at the roulette table, some players encounter pitfalls that can tarnish their experience:

  • Illusory Control: Players may fall prey to the misconception that strategies can override the inherent randomness of the game, leading to misguided confidence.
  • Table Limits: High rollers may find themselves restricted by table limits, curbing their ability to fully implement aggressive strategies such as the Martingale.
  • Emotional Decision-Making: The thrill of the game can cloud judgment, resulting in impulsive bets that deviate from strategic plans.
